The invoice that arrives is not the cost that matters

Rent is the number everyone knows because it turns up monthly with a building attached to it. Run the defaults here and rent is roughly a third of what the warehouse costs to operate. Labor is larger. Add equipment and the amortised racking and the storage side — the part that would still cost money if nothing moved all month — is somewhere under half.

That ratio is the reason a single cost per position is a useful summary and a poor pricing instrument. Two customers occupying a hundred positions each can consume wildly different amounts of the total, because one turns their stock weekly and the other stores a seasonal item that arrives once and leaves once. A blended rate charges both the same and loses money on one of them.

Occupied positions, not positions

The cost is fixed against the positions you built, and the revenue or the value comes from the positions holding something. At 88 percent occupancy the cost per occupied position is about 14 percent higher than the headline figure, and the gap grows fast as occupancy falls — at 70 percent it is over 40 percent higher.

This is where the temptation to run at very high occupancy comes from, and it is worth resisting past a point. A warehouse at 95 percent occupancy has no room to receive a large inbound, no room to consolidate, and no room to hold anything while it is counted, so the labor cost of every move rises to pay for the storage saving. The right occupancy target is the one where the two curves cross for your operation, and it is usually lower than the number that looks efficient on a spreadsheet.

Using this to price work for other people

If the output is going into a quote, split it before it goes anywhere near a customer. Storage cost per position per month covers rent, building and racking, and it is genuinely a per-position-per-month thing. Handling cost per pallet moved covers labor and equipment, and it is genuinely a per-move thing. Quoting them separately is not an accounting nicety, it is the only structure that survives a customer whose volume changes.

Then add whatever margin the work is worth, remembering that this calculator produces cost and nothing else. It has no view on what anyone should charge, no market rate built in, and no idea what your competitors do. Questions people ask

What is a normal cost per pallet position?

No figure worth quoting exists, and this page deliberately ships without one. The result depends on rent in your market, the age and height of the building, how many positions the layout achieved per square foot, wage levels, how much handling the stock demands, and whether racking was inherited or bought last year. Two operations a mile apart can differ by a factor of two on identical freight. The number that means something is your own, calculated from your own inputs and tracked against itself over time.

Should empty positions be costed?

They already are, which is the point of showing the occupied figure separately. Rent, racking and most of the building cost are incurred whether a position holds anything or not, so the total divides across every position you built while only the occupied ones do any work. Some operations then allocate the empty-position cost across the occupied ones, which produces the higher per-occupied figure here and is the honest number for pricing. Others treat it as the cost of available capacity and hold it centrally. Both are defensible; what is not defensible is quoting the lower number and being surprised at the year end.

Why is handling separated from storage?

Because they scale with completely different things and mixing them hides that. Storage cost follows how long a pallet stays; handling cost follows how many times it is touched. A blended rate per position charges a fast turning customer and a slow one the same, which means one of them is subsidising the other and nothing in the reporting reveals which. Third party warehouses price the two lines separately for exactly this reason, and the split is just as useful internally, since it tells you whether a cost problem is a building problem or a labor problem.

Is amortising the racking the same as depreciating it?

No. Spreading an installed cost over a chosen number of years is an estimating device for comparing operating scenarios month to month. Depreciation is an accounting treatment with rules about capitalisation, useful life and method, and racking installed in a leased building is often treated as a leasehold improvement tied to the lease term rather than to the physical life of the steel. Those two treatments produce different monthly numbers, and the accounting one is the one that belongs in your books. Use this for decisions, not for reporting.

How do I count pallets handled?

Count every touch that consumes labor, not every pallet in the building. A pallet received and later shipped is two moves. If it is put away, replenished to a pick face and then picked from, it is more than two, and if your operation does a lot of that, counting only receipts and shipments will understate the handling cost per move substantially. The cleanest source is your system's transaction count rather than an estimate, because the moves people forget are exactly the internal ones that make up the difference.
